Technical Specifications
Model Details
- Part Number: P29156-001
- Manufacturer: HPE
- Series: SN8700B Director Switch
- Slot Count: 8 slots (modular architecture)
- Port Speeds: 16/32/64 Gbps Fibre Channel
- Total Port Count: Up to 512 FC ports
- Cooling: Redundant, hot-swappable fans
- Power Supplies: Dual redundant, hot-swappable
- Management: CLI, GUI, REST API, SANnav
- Redundancy: Full system-level redundancy with failover

P29156-001 HPE SN8700B 8 Slot Director SPS Core Blade Switch Overview
The P29156-001 HPE SN8700B 8 Slot Director SPS Core Blade Switch is a high-performance, enterprise-class networking component engineered for data center environments that demand uncompromising reliability, scalability, and throughput. As part of Hewlett Packard Enterprise's cutting-edge SN8700B switch series, this specific model supports extensive fiber channel capabilities, massive bandwidth, and superior redundancy, making it ideal for mission-critical workloads in large-scale enterprise or cloud data center environments.
Advanced Architecture of the HPE SN8700B Core Blade Switch
Designed with modular scalability in mind, the HPE SN8700B features an 8-slot chassis that can support a variety of blade configurations. Each blade is engineered to provide maximum throughput while maintaining minimal latency. The modular nature allows data center administrators to adapt the switch's performance based on current and future needs.
High-Speed Fabric Architecture
With the inclusion of the Director SPS (Switching Power Supply) core blade, the switch guarantees stable power distribution across the fabric modules. The high-speed backplane ensures that bandwidth is never a bottleneck, even under demanding traffic loads. The SN8700B switch series, including the P29156-001 model, is engineered to handle up to 512 Fibre Channel ports, each supporting speeds up to 64 Gbps.
Dynamic Slot Management
The switch’s 8-slot architecture supports a combination of control processor blades, core switching blades, and port blades. This separation of control and data paths improves system stability and performance under various configurations. It allows IT teams to tailor the hardware to exact operational demands while ensuring high availability.
Data Center-Class Performance and Reliability
The P29156-001 HPE SN8700B switch has been built to support enterprise-level redundancy and uptime. By incorporating hot-swappable components, dual redundant power supplies, and redundant cooling, it supports 24/7 operation without compromising performance or reliability.
Redundancy and High Availability Features
Every component within the SN8700B director-class switch is built with redundancy in mind. From power to cooling fans, everything is hot-swappable and operates under a non-disruptive architecture. Redundant switching cores ensure no single point of failure can jeopardize system uptime. Failover occurs instantly, allowing workloads to continue seamlessly.
Failover Capabilities
The SN8700B supports stateful failover for its control processor modules, ensuring that system states are retained during switchover events. This makes it ideal for financial, healthcare, and government applications where uptime is critical.
Firmware Upgrade Without Downtime
With features like non-disruptive firmware upgrades, enterprises can ensure their networking hardware stays up-to-date without any interruptions in service.
Flexible Deployment Scenarios and Use Cases
The modular design and robust feature set of the SN8700B 8-slot core blade switch allow it to be deployed in various environments, ranging from enterprise data centers to managed service provider (MSP) facilities and hyperscale cloud architectures.
Large-Scale SAN (Storage Area Network) Environments
The SN8700B supports high-density Fibre Channel connectivity, making it a premier choice for modern SAN deployments. It supports zoning, trunking, and multipathing, which are essential for managing complex storage networks.
Multi-Tenant Cloud and Virtualized Data Centers
The SN8700B’s ability to isolate and prioritize traffic through quality-of-service (QoS) policies allows cloud providers to manage tenant workloads efficiently. It supports NPIV (N_Port ID Virtualization) and virtual fabric technology, enabling maximum flexibility and scalability.
Comprehensive Management Capabilities
Managing the SN8700B is simplified through a suite of HPE and Brocade software tools designed for full visibility and control over data flow, hardware health, and security policies.
HPE SANnav Management Software Integration
HPE SANnav provides a centralized graphical user interface (GUI) and automation framework for managing SN8700B switches. This includes real-time monitoring, performance analysis, proactive alerting, and historical trending.
Command-Line Interface (CLI) and Scripting
Network administrators also benefit from a powerful CLI and RESTful API support, allowing for detailed configuration management and integration into DevOps workflows. Scripting and automation streamline operations, reducing manual errors and improving efficiency.
Security and Compliance Features
The SN8700B includes a suite of security features designed to meet enterprise compliance requirements. Features such as role-based access control (RBAC), RADIUS/TACACS+ authentication, and secure firmware downloads ensure the integrity of your network fabric.
Role-Based Access Control
RBAC ensures that different levels of administrative access are available for various users. This helps in limiting accidental or unauthorized changes while maintaining secure access protocols.
Encryption and Data Integrity
Although native encryption is handled primarily at the storage level, the SN8700B supports secure management sessions and encrypted communication channels between devices to ensure data in motion is protected.
Energy Efficiency and Environmental Considerations
The SN8700B switch is engineered to be energy efficient, with intelligent power and thermal management features. Each module is optimized for minimal power draw while delivering high data throughput.
Smart Cooling and Thermal Sensors
Integrated thermal sensors monitor internal temperatures, allowing the system to dynamically adjust fan speeds and power draw to reduce energy consumption. This supports enterprise sustainability initiatives without sacrificing performance.
Energy Star and RoHS Compliance
The SN8700B series adheres to global standards for energy efficiency and environmental compliance, including RoHS (Restriction of Hazardous Substances) and Energy Star certifications. This ensures responsible energy use and environmental impact.
Scalability for Future Data Center Growth
As data centers continue to expand their virtualization and storage needs, the P29156-001 HPE SN8700B remains a future-proof investment. Its modular design and scalable performance allow enterprises to expand capacity without replacing the core infrastructure.
Seamless Expansion
Additional slot modules can be added without requiring downtime or disrupting service. This allows businesses to grow their infrastructure organically as demand increases, reducing the need for large upfront capital investment.
Support for Emerging Technologies
The SN8700B supports emerging storage technologies, including NVMe over Fibre Channel and Gen 7 Fibre Channel, preparing your data center for future standards and compatibility.
Compatibility with Existing HPE Infrastructure
The P29156-001 HPE SN8700B is designed for seamless integration with existing HPE ecosystem components, including HPE Primera, Nimble Storage, and HPE Alletra storage arrays. It ensures compatibility across your storage fabric, minimizing integration costs.
Unified Fabric Architecture
Using standardized interfaces and protocols, the SN8700B supports a unified fabric that simplifies infrastructure management while ensuring consistent performance across servers and storage arrays.
